Linux改变系统时区的简单方法(linux改时区)

Linux是一种开源的操作系统,它具有高效、稳定、可扩展和安全性能,在许多领域(人工智能、云计算、嵌入式系统等)得到广泛应用。系统的时区也是用户经常要改变的系统设置项,本文介绍了Linux改变系统时区的简单方法。

首先,进入Linux系统终端输入以下指令:

timedatectl

此指令将显示有关系统时区的信息,例如当前时区:

 Local time: Tue 2019-08-20 12:13:44 UTC 
Universal time: Tue 2019-08-20 12:13:44 UTC
RTC time: Tue 2019-08-20 12:13:44
Time zone: Etc/UTC (UTC, +0000)
NTP enabled: no
NTP synchronized: yes

若要改变系统时区,可以使用以下简单指令:

sudo timedatectl set-timezone Asia/Shanghai

此指令将把系统时间改为上海时区。如果需要更改其他时区,可以改变第一个参数即可。

由于Linux系统时间一般由硬件时钟来确定,因此对系统时间的修改将一直存在,除非重新启动计算机。所以如果修改过系统时区后想要回到之前的时区,可以使用以下指令:

sudo timedatectl set-timezone UTC

这句指令将把系统时间重新设置为通用协调时(UTC),在各个全球地区,这可以很好地作为统一参照时间,让各地的活动具有一致性。

当然,改变系统时区也可以在/etc/localtime文件中完成。首先使用指令修改时区,然后再重新确定这个文件:

sudo timedatectl set-timezone Asia/Shanghai
sudo 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ime

这样就完成了Linux改变系统时区的简单方法。上面的指令都可以使系统的时区设置更加精确,从而帮助各个用户以正确的时间表示出他们的工作成果。


数据运维技术 » Linux改变系统时区的简单方法(linux改时区)